Winter guard utilizes the flags, rifles, sabers and dance traditionally associated with marching bands and drum corps and puts them in an indoor setting. This activity combines the beauty and pageantry of dance, the drama of theater, and the precision of marching band into one production. Pride participates in competitions with Winter Guard International (WGI).
In the winter guard arena, Pride strives to set standards within the color guard activity while maintaining a positive experience for the members and audience alike. From being one of the first color guards to use a floor covering, to exhilarating championship performances, members have always displayed the joy of performing and grown from the challenge of working as a team.
Currently, this color guard thrills and inspires audiences at local shows in the Tri-State Circuit for Pageantry Arts and MEPA. Pride of Cincinnati also participates in several WGI sponsored regional contests. These regional contests lead to the WGI World Championships, held in April every year. The Pride of Cincinnati has been a regular finalist in the WGI Independent World Class.
Pride was also the Winter Guard International Independent World Class Champions,winning the Gold Medal in 2001, 2005, and 2007.
